Percent means parts per hundred or out of hundred. The symbol of a percent is %.
For example, 25% means 25 per 100 or, \(\frac{25}{100}\)
Percentage is a fraction written with a denominator 100.
Conversion of fraction or decimal into percent
For the conversion of a fraction or decimal into percent multiply it by 100 and put the symbol % to the product. For example,
\(\frac{2}{5}\) =\(\frac{2}{5}\) × 100 % = 40 %
0.3 = 0.3× 100 % = 30 %
Conversion of percent into fraction or decimal
For the conversion of percent into fraction or decimal, divide it by 100 and remove the % symbol. For example,
20% =\(\frac{20}{100}\) =\(\frac{1}{5}\)
32% =\(\frac{32}{100}\) = 0.32
To express a given quantity as the percent of whole quantity
For the expression of the given quantity as the fraction of the whole quantity, then multiply the fraction by 100%. For examples,
20 as the percent of 80 =\(\frac{20}{80}\) × 100 = 25%
To find the value of given percent of a quantity
If this case is given, then multiply the quantity by the given percent. Then, convert the percent into a fraction and simplify. For example,
25% of Rs.250 = 25%× 250 =\(\frac{25}{100}\)× 250 = Rs. 62.5 ans.
To find a quantity whose value of certain percent is given
If this case is given, we can suppose the whole quantity by a variable such as x. Then we can form an equation and by solving the equation we can find the value of x. For example,
If 20% of a sum is Rs. 80. Find the sum
Here, Let the sum be Rs.x
Now, 20% of x = Rs.80
or, \(\frac{20}{100}\)× x = Rs. 80
or, \(\frac{x}{5}\) = Rs.80
or, x =Rs. 80 × 5 = Rs.400
\(\frac{3}{20}\) of the number of students of a class were absent on a day. Find the percentage of present students.
Solution:
Here,
\(\frac{3}{20}\) = \(\frac{3}{20}\) × 100% = 15%
∴ percentage of absentes = 15%
Now,
the percentage of present students = 100% - 15%
= 85 %
If 40% of the people in a village are illiterate, what fraction of the people are literate?
Solution:
Here,
40% = \(\frac{40}{100}\) = \(\frac{2}{5}\)
∴ Fractions of illiterate people = \(\frac{2}{5}\)
Now,
the fraction of literate people = 1 - \(\frac{2}{5}\) = \(\frac{3}{5}\)
Sameer obtained 60 marks out of 80 full marks ion Maths. Express his marks in percentage.
Solution:
Here,
60 as the percentage of 80 = \(\frac{60}{80}\) × 100%
75%
So, he obtained 75% marks.
The rate of a price of petrol is increased from Rs 50 per liter to Rs 55 per liter. Find the percentage increase in the price.
Solution:
Here,
the initial rate of a price = Rs 50 per liter
The new rate of a price = rs 55 per liter
∴ Increment in the rate price = Rs 55 - Rs 50 = rs 5
Now,
the increment percentage = \(\frac{Increment \; price}{Initial \; price}\) × 100%
= \(\frac{Rs \; 5}{Rs \; 50}\) × 100%
= 10%
So, the rate of a price of petrol is increased by 10%

Father spends 65% of his monthly income to run the family and the rest he saves in a bank. If he saves Rs 2800 in the bank, how much does he spend every month?
Solution:
Let his monthly income be Rs x.
Here,
His saving percentage = 100% - 65%
= 35%
Now,
or, 35% of x = Rs 2800
or, \(\frac{35}{100}\) × x = Rs 2800
or, \(\frac{7x}{20}\) = Rs 2800
or, x = \(\frac{20 \; × \; Rs 2800}{7}\)
or, x = Rs 8000
∴ His monthly income = Rs 8000
Now,
His monthly income = Rs 8000 - Rs 2800
Rs 5200
So, he spends Rs 5200 every month
There are 225 boys in a school which is 75% of the total number of students. Find the number of girls in the school.
Solution:
Let, the total number of students in the school be x.
Here,
or, 75% of x = 225
or, \(\frac{75}{100}\) × x = 225
or, \(\frac{3x}{4}\) = 225
or, x = \(\frac{4 × 225}{3}\)
or, x = 300
So, the total number of students in the school is 300,
Again,
Number of girls = 300 - 225
So, there are 75 girls in the school.
